Spain wins the 2008 European Championship
Euro 2008 Final
Spain 1 - 0 Germany
It wasn't the most exciting or goal-filled game of the tournament, but Spain won't mind as they
held on for a 1-0 win over Germany for their first European Championship in 44 years. Fernando
Torres, who was overshadowed by his strike partner David Villa in the previous rounds,
scored the winning goal for Spain.
